Frequently Asked Questions About Plumbing in Collinsville

Get answers to common questions about plumbing services in Collinsville, Illinois.

1What are the most common plumbing issues for Collinsville homeowners, especially related to our climate?

The most frequent issues are frozen and burst pipes in winter due to our Illinois temperature swings, and sewer line backups from invasive tree roots common in older Collinsville neighborhoods. In spring, sump pump failures become a major concern due to heavy Midwest rains and the area's clay soil, which doesn't drain quickly. Regular maintenance targeting these seasonal and local factors is key to prevention.

2How do I choose a reliable plumber in Collinsville, and are there specific local licenses I should verify?

Always choose a plumber licensed by the State of Illinois Department of Public Health; you can verify this license online. For Collinsville specifically, it's also wise to select a provider familiar with local codes, such as those for backflow prevention devices required by the Collinsville Water Department, and one with a physical local address for faster emergency response during our severe weather events.

3What is the typical cost range for common plumbing services like water heater replacement or drain cleaning in the Collinsville area?

Costs vary, but for context, a standard 50-gallon water heater replacement in Collinsville typically ranges from $1,200 to $2,500 installed, influenced by local fuel costs and the type (gas or electric). Hydro-jetting a main sewer line to clear roots often costs $350-$600, which can be higher than simple snaking due to the prevalence of older, root-prone lines in historic parts of town.

4When is the best time to schedule non-emergency plumbing maintenance in Collinsville?

Schedule critical maintenance like sump pump checks and outdoor faucet winterization in early fall, before the first hard freeze. For sewer line inspections or replacements, late spring or summer is ideal when the ground is thawed and drier, making excavation easier and less damaging to your landscape. Avoid the peak winter emergency season, as wait times and prices may be higher.

5Are there any Collinsville-specific regulations or programs I should know about for plumbing repairs or replacements?

Yes, Collinsville has specific ordinances. For example, any work on the sewer lateral from your house to the city main requires a permit from the Public Works Department. Furthermore, the city occasionally offers financial assistance or rebate programs for replacing inefficient fixtures or water heaters; checking the City of Collinsville's official website or contacting their utilities division for current incentives is recommended.
